INFORMATION/BACKGROUND
The proposed contract will be utilized by the Facilities and Fleet Services Departments for the procurement
of equipment trailers and related repair services, if required, for various city departments and Fleet assets.
These trailers will include flatbed, utility, enclosed, and specialty equipment options. Trailer replacements
are recommended by Fleet Services annually as part of the vehicle and equipment replacement program,
which identifies necessary replacements based on a point scale. New trailer additions to the City’s fleet are
approved in the City’s Capital Budget.
The current City fleet has 234 trailers with a life expectancy of 15 years. Fleet Services is replacing trailers
by receiving quotes for each due to limited contract resources, causing a delay in trailer acquisitions. The
immediate need for fiscal year 2023-24 is the replacement of 29 trailers, with a projected need in fiscal year
2024-25 to replace 41 trailers. Trailer costs range from $5,000 to $50,000 depending on the size and
capability needed, with most acquisitions averaging $10,000.

Request for Proposals was sent to 101 prospective suppliers, including 78 Denton firms. In addition,
specifications were placed on the Procurement website for prospective suppliers to download and advertised
in the local newspaper. Four (4) proposals were received, and references were checked to ensure the vendor
can provide the services requested in the Scope of Work. The proposals were evaluated based upon the
published criteria including delivery, compliance with specifications, probable performance, and price. Best
and Final Offer (BAFO) was requested from both firms. The department is awarding a contract to Fuhltilt
Industries LLC, dba North DFW Trailers as the primary vendor, and Bragg Trailers, L.C.C., as the
secondary vendor.

FISCAL INFORMATION
These services will be funded from the Fleet Services operating budget and allocated to departments as
costs are incurred and acquisitions will be funded through capital funds. The budgeted amount for this item
is $1,500,000. The City will only pay for services rendered and is not obligated to pay the full contract
amount unless needed.
